Company Financials
ITC remains a financial powerhouse in the Indian FMCG and cigarette sector. For the quarter ending March 2025, ITC posted a net profit of Rs 4,874 crore, which is up 0.8% year-on-year. Revenue from operations also grew 9.6% to Rs 17,248 crore. Despite these solid numbers, the company’s shares have seen a decline of about 10.8% so far in 2025, partly due to global investor activity and sectoral headwinds.
Recent News About ITC
This is BAT’s second major stake sale in ITC in recent years. Last year, BAT sold 3.5% of its holding for about Rs 16,690 crore in one of India’s largest block deals. After the latest sale, BAT’s stake in ITC will reduce from 25.4% to roughly 23.1%, but it will remain the largest single shareholder.
BAT has stated that the funds from this sale will be used to reduce debt and support its global share buyback programme. BAT’s CEO, Tadeu Marroco, emphasized ITC’s strategic importance, calling it a “valued associate” in a high-growth market.
